The High Resolution Imaging Channel (HRIC) of the Spectrometer and Imagers for Mpo Bepicolombo Integrated Observatory – System (SIMBIO-SYS) onboard the BepiColombo mission to Mercury, is the visible imaging camera devoted to the detailed characterization of the Hermean surface. The potential huge amount of data that HRIC can produce must cope with the allocated mission resources in terms of power, data volume, and pointing maneuvers while accomplishing the scientific objectives of the mission. The purpose of this work is to present a preliminary approach for planning the HRIC observations during the nominal scientific phase and to discuss the outcomes of a test simulation which highlights the complexity of the planning process and the possible conflicts with respect to available resources.
